Q: How do you get a natural-blonde look around the face without it becoming streaky or grown-out looking?

A: "Work with the natural flow of the hair, as well as the client’s hair line," says Pravana Educator Lissette Cruz from The Color Bar Salon in Orlando. "Following the natural hair line will help your
final look flow better when the client pulls her hair back. Additionally, taking smaller sections allows you to get closer to the scalp. Using smaller foils helps support the section and prevent drag. Lastly, for intricate applications, use the right tint brush. Thick and bulky tint brushes leave you with too much product. Use a sleeker, thinner brush for just the right amount of product when doing finer detailing."
